Output be8e7bae18273d24f95f14d2368baa48c27432888da0f37bf0d79dea0449ee7d:10

value
565173
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7e51676f2618bf5a60b1d7810b68e300b37ad84a OP_EQUAL
address
3DCvamPqSz91EC5oa5pbMQwKuVynJZRzxJ
transaction
be8e7bae18273d24f95f14d2368baa48c27432888da0f37bf0d79dea0449ee7d
confirmations
239052
spent
true